Château Gruaud Larose

Saint-Julien Red Bordeaux Blend 2010

Slightly deeper ruby with a little narrower , less garnet rim . This is quite deep and slightly more herbal on the nose, floral perhaps , a little more austere. Spicy Cassis , tobacco , herbal touches . On the palate this is slightly more velvety with a riper dark fruits , mixed with a touch of dark cherry , spice and subtler , riper tannin . Quite ripe , more polished tannin. A bit bigger and riper in style , alcohol a bit more noticeable . Quite good dark cherry , dark chocolate, cassis finish . This is a little more polished , but probably needs a little more time , better in 5 years and will last well a further 10 . Overall a good showing , a classy , polished performance — 3 months ago

This was a rather fascinating evening put together by our incredibly generous host. All 2007 reds were served blind in two flights: 1st Mouton, Haut Brion, Cheval Blanc , La Mission Haut Brion then Latour , Lafite , Petrus and Margaux . Overall the wines showed well , and were mostly enjoyable to drink now , though there is no rush . This somewhat maligned vintage can give a lot of enjoyment in the right environment, I certainly wouldn’t hold back from opening or purchasing any of these wines . They mostly show good density of fruit , personality and elegance , with good freshness. These are not powerful wines , and at times perhaps the fruit can be a little cooler or greener but I was pleasantly surprised by the way they performed , just goes to show you should never write off a vintage without trying the wines !

Château Mouton Rothschild

Pauillac Red Bordeaux Blend 2007

No formal notes . medium deep ruby , medium bright ruby rim. Quite spicy a little oak noticeable at first . Mixed dark fruits . A bit more round and juicy on the palate , good acidity , slightly grippy but polished tannins . This becomes a bit more restrained and reserved after a while. Served blind , I actually put this as Haut Brion , due to its generous personality, and polished tannins. Overall showed well in the flight was my top wine (though the Cheval Blanc may well be better in absolute terms) . Can be enjoyed now , though has the substance to last a further decade or so, a good showing for the Mouton. — 3 months ago
